Short-term Impact on Financial Markets
The launch of the Gemini Credit Card could lead to an immediate uptick in interest in both cryptocurrencies and crypto-related financial products. Here's how:
1. Increased Demand for Cryptocurrencies: As consumers earn crypto rewards, this may lead to increased investments in cryptocurrencies. This could drive up prices in the short term, particularly for popular cryptocurrencies like Bitcoin (BTC) and Ethereum (ETH).
2. Market Volatility: The initial excitement around the credit card could lead to increased trading volumes and volatility in cryptocurrency markets. Investors may buy into cryptocurrencies in anticipation of reward earnings, leading to short-term price surges.
3. Impact on Crypto-Related Stocks: Companies involved in the cryptocurrency ecosystem, such as Coinbase (COIN) and Block (SQ), may see a short-term boost in their stock prices due to increased consumer engagement with cryptocurrencies.

Long-term Impact on Financial Markets
In the long run, the introduction of the Gemini Credit Card could have several significant effects:
1. Mainstream Adoption of Cryptocurrencies: As more consumers use credit cards that offer crypto rewards, we could witness a shift towards mainstream adoption of cryptocurrencies. This could lead to greater acceptance of digital currencies in everyday transactions, thus stabilizing their value.
2. Increased Regulatory Scrutiny: With the rise of crypto rewards programs, regulators may step in to ensure consumer protection, potentially leading to stricter regulations for cryptocurrency transactions. This could affect the operational dynamics of crypto companies and their stock valuations.
3. Integration of Crypto in Traditional Finance: The Gemini Credit Card represents a blending of traditional finance with the crypto world. Over time, we may see more traditional financial institutions adopting similar models, which could lead to innovative products and services in the financial sector.
